The Legacy of Vanderland

Vanderland Boots traces its origins to the late 19th century when shoemaking was an art form passed down through generations. The brand was founded by Johan Vanderland, a master cobbler in a small European town known for its skilled artisans. Johan’s vision was simple yet profound: to create boots that were not only durable but also comfortable and stylish enough to be worn on any occasion.

From the outset, Vanderland Boots were crafted using the finest leathers and materials, with every stitch and detail meticulously executed by hand. The brand quickly gained a reputation for quality, and its boots became a favorite among workers, adventurers, and even the aristocracy. The boots were not just footwear; they were a symbol of resilience, reliability, and refined taste.

Craftsmanship Meets Innovation

What sets Vanderland Boots apart from other footwear brands is its unwavering commitment to craftsmanship. Each pair of boots undergoes a rigorous production process that combines traditional shoemaking techniques with modern technology. The brand continues to use high-quality, ethically sourced leather, which is tanned using natural methods that enhance durability and create a rich patina over time.

One of the signature features of Vanderland Boots is the Goodyear welt construction, a labor-intensive process that involves stitching the upper part of the boot to the sole using a strip of leather. This method not only ensures the boots’ longevity but also allows for easy resoling, making Vanderland Boots an investment that can last a lifetime.

While the brand remains rooted in tradition, it has also embraced innovation to meet the needs of the modern consumer. Vanderland has integrated advanced cushioning systems and moisture-wicking linings into its boots, ensuring that they are as comfortable as they are durable. The soles are designed to provide excellent traction, making the boots suitable for various terrains and weather conditions.

A Style for Every Occasion

Vanderland Boots offer a versatile range of styles that cater to different tastes and occasions. Whether you’re looking for a rugged pair of work boots, sleek dress boots, or something in between, Vanderland has something to offer.

The classic Chelsea boot, for example, is a staple in the Vanderland collection. With its clean lines and minimalist design, it pairs effortlessly with both casual and formal attire. The lace-up combat boots, on the other hand, are perfect for those who prefer a more rugged and edgy look. These boots feature reinforced toe caps and thick soles, making them ideal for outdoor adventures.

For those who appreciate a touch of luxury, Vanderland’s handcrafted dress boots are a must-have. These boots are made from the finest calfskin leather and feature intricate brogue detailing, giving them a sophisticated and timeless appeal. Whether worn with a tailored suit or dressed down with jeans, these boots exude elegance and refinement.
